Spanish unions CCOO and UGT are topping the list of #unions4climate actions: they have joined a flashmob calling for renewable energies, launched a manifesto with civil society allies under the #alianzaporelclima, and handed the letter to the Spanish negotiators to the UNFCCC. Bravo!

Thanks to the Finnish unions Finland considers that the Principles of the Article 3 under the Framework Agreement meaning the Gender sensitivity of Climate Actions, Respect for Human Rights, Just Transition and Decent Work should be important guiding principles of the New Agreement and should be included in the Agreement itself.

On 4th June, a delegation from the trade union CITUB met the Bulgarian Environment Minister, Ivelina Vassileva.
